SBC PureConsult was formed in February 2001 in order to deliver first class specialist consultancy services to
the Microsoft and Citrix reseller community in the UK and Europe. With over 10 years first hand experience
of implementing 'Server based Computing' and virtualisation solutions we have the ability to cut through the nonsense and terminology and deliver comprehensive solutions based upon Citrix XenApp, VSphere and
Microsoft Windows infrastructures.
 
The UK Reseller channel constantly struggles to retain quality staff with up to date experience and training. Whilst this problem will never go away, the pace of change can be matched through outsourcing the delivery
of key skills on large projects through a combination of partnership and subcontracting.
 
SBC PureConsult maintains a client base of both private clients and reseller partners. In general terms, the emphasis is upon resellers maximising their existing customer potential whilst benefiting from the experience gathered through many direct engagements that we have completed. In delivering pure consultancy services our customers can be confident that their existing software, hardware and licensing channels are not compromised, allowing us to concentrate on the business of helping customers achieve their goals.
